Why Patriots fans can't mock the Bills anymore

Among the many things brought to mind by Whitney Houston's sudden death this weekend, was this realization I had (which is probably too much of an insight into how my mind works): Patriots fans can't make fun of the Bills anymore in the wake of this latest Super Bowl loss.

First, how we got here. Among the memories stirred by the death of Ms. Houston was her stirring rendition of the National Anthem before Super Bowl XXV. That Super Bowl is remembered for two things: that anthem and, well, let's call it "the final play," shall we?

However, this dawned on me as I was remembering that Super Bowl: The Patriots have now lost as many Super Bowls as the Bills have. For that matter, they've also lost as many as the Broncos and the Vikings, but that's not the point here.

And for those who point out the Patriots do have three rings to the Bills', um, zero, yes that is some salve for the soul, but here's the sobering kicker: the Patriots have now lost twice as many Super Bowls in heartbreaking fashion to the New York Giants as the Bills have.
